Virtual Yashima Domain 33 Kannon Pilgrimage #28 Jion-ji Temple

 

     The Oi Family, which was later called the Yashima Family, died out in 1593, and their base, Nejo Fortress, was destroyed by Nikaho Kiyoshige (1560-1624).  Kaneko Abetaro was subject to the Yashima Family.  He rose up against the Nikaho Family, and held Aka-date Fortress, but was killed in battle around the fortress.

     It is unknown when Jion-ji Temple was founded at the foot of Aka-date Fortress.  It was the family temple of Abetaro.
